&lt;p&gt;MISSION: Learn about cinco de mayo. &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;SOURCE: Diego&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;DETAILS: So apparently Cinco de Mayo is not Mexico&amp;#8217;s independence day&amp;#8230; that would be September 16th. The date is observed in the United States as Mexican heritage day, however in the state of Puebla, the day commemorates the Mexican victory over the French at the battle of Puebla on May 5th, 1862. I never knew.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;MISSION: Google Gregor MacGregor and read his story. &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;SOURCE: Angel&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;DETAILS: Gregor MacGregor was a Scottish sailor, soldier and colonizer who, in 1820 returned to London from a trip to Latin America announcing that he had been made the Cheif of Poyais (a small nation off the coast of Honduras). He described the royal family, buildings and opera house to investors who were all too eager to give MacGregor capital. &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Three years later colonists boarded two ships and headed to Poyais to live in the great cities that MacGregor had described. The problem, however, is that Poyais didn&amp;#8217;t exist. The only land MacGregor had any claim to was swamp land which was anything but inhabitable. Rescue ships were contacted, but due to disease (and even one suicide), only 50 of the 240 made it back. &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;This is a ridiculous scam topped off with the fact that Gregor had exchanged his settlers money for fake Poyais currency, which he had printed in Scotland. Interesting story though.
